Capturing the essence of a quaint Dutch town, the painting by the renowned Dutch artist A. Horsmans offers a mesmerizing vista from the tranquil gracht, or canal, adorned with cargo boats. with meticulous attention to detail and mastery of impressionist techniques, Horsmans vividly portrays the bustling atmosphere of Dutch city life on canvas. The vibrant color palette and refined painting techniques evoke a sense of movement and vitality, drawing the viewer into the heart of the scene. from the intricate reflections on the water’s surface to the charming architecture, every aspect of the composition is executed with precision and finesse. The painting is signed by the artist in the lower right corner as “A. Horsmans”. It is elegantly framed in a high-quality Dutch baroque frame.
